{"title":"Mega Bog","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eMega Bog is an American singer and songwriter known for her unique blend of folk, jazz, and experimental music. With a captivating voice and introspective lyrics, she has gained a dedicated following in the indie music scene. Mega Bog's songs are characterized by their dreamy melodies and poetic storytelling, creating a truly immersive listening experience. Her latest album showcases her growth as an artist, with intricate arrangements and thought-provoking themes. Whether performing solo or with a band, Mega Bog never fails to captivate audiences with her raw talent and emotive performances.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"end-of-everything-2","title":"End of Everything","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003ci\u003eEnd of Everything\u003c\/i\u003e is the intrepid seventh album from Mega Bog, a nightmarish experimental pop ensemble led by Erin Elizabeth Birgy. In 2020, Birgy was surrounded by seemingly endless turmoil: mass death, a burning planet, and a personal reckoning when past traumas met fresh ones. Living in Los Angeles, against the backdrop of brilliantly horrifying forest fires, she questioned what perspective to use moving forward in such dumbfounded awe. Deciding to seize something tangible, she produced a record that spoke of surrender, of mourning, and support in the face of tumultuous self-reflection.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Mexican Summer","offers":[{"title":"Black LP","offer_id":50454196977995,"sku":"2011521","price":24.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"CD","offer_id":50454196683083,"sku":"2011520","price":14.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"LP","offer_id":50454197535051,"sku":"2011522","price":11.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0867\/1120\/6219\/files\/184923133769_2_7b118195_thumbnail_4096.jpg?v=1727182037"},{"product_id":"life-and-another","title":"Life, and Another","description":"\u003cp\u003eThe magical Mega Bog returns with another fantastical off-world transmission, the most sophisticated, exploratory, and accessible statement yet from surrealist songwriter and avant-pop prospector Erin Birgy. Featuring James Krivchenia (Big Thief), who co-produced, and Zach Burba (iji) among its cast of vibrant players, Life, and Another bristles with painterly technicolor surface textures while plumbing fathomless depths of feeling.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eCohabiting with Life, and Another’s co-producer, engineer, and percussionist James Krivchenia (Big Thief) in a small cabin near the Rio Grande off of NM State Route 68, Birgy found herself often alone, suspended between their separate touring schedules. In these silent time passages, Birgy experienced a complete loss of self amid the expanse. Frequently thinking about death in the middle of nowhere opened a familiar black hole of troubling projections, and any desire to find freedom or remain positive continued to fold back into self-destructive thought and fear. New, northern landscapes, like the woods and rivers outside of Seattle, Washington, provided inspiration during odd sublets in the area. Dark as everything may actually be, Birgy always manages to stay with trouble and conjure the extraordinary resulting music.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eRecorded over several sessions in various studios Life bleeds with instrumental contributions from longtime and new collaborators, including Aaron Otheim, Zach Burba of iji, Will Segerstrom, Matt Bachmann, Andrew Dorset of Lake, James Krivchenia of Big Thief, Meg Duffy of Hand Habits, Jade Tcimpidis, Alex Liebman, and co-engineers Geoff Treager and Phil Hartunian. Listeners know by now they can trust Mega Bog to continuously lead them into deeper and wilder, spiritual pop territories. She is joined on her fifth and finest album (and first for PoB) by members of Big Thief, Hand Habits, and iji, who help her spin a manic web of emotions into beautiful, abstract future poems and thrilling genre perversions.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e title of Mega Bog’s newest album \u003ci\u003eDolphine\u003c\/i\u003e is inspired by a myth that suggests that, as humankind evolved from sea creatures, some individuals chose not to leave the water and walk the earth, but rather to stay in the ocean and explore the darkness as dolphins. (The extra “e” was added to take the word out of the everyday, translating it into a potential futuristic dialect.) The songwriting was inspired by Erin’s own swim through a myriad of overwhelming emotions, including the ongoing mourning following the death of her childhood horse companion Rose, her navigation of the feelings and physicality of two abortions, and the hapless and shattering social, political, and environmental turmoil on the planet. \u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eIn October of 2016, Erin took her dark sketches to the Outlier Inn studio in Woodridge, NY, with a passionate crew of deeply bonded musicians. Together, they arranged and executed these eleven dizzy pop songs, live, over a tight seven days. The completed sound is thick and inviting. Bellowing, breathless vocals, mystical lyrics with the presence of poetry and the intuitive logic of dreams, and promiscuous, sometimes dissonant chord structures swirl together, coalescing into hazy and hypnotic fantasies. \u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Paradise of Bachelors","offers":[{"title":"CD","offer_id":50498255749451,"sku":"1061937","price":14.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0867\/1120\/6219\/files\/19c1f332-9042-4a18-a6fe-ac1748f27ee0_thumbnail_4096.jpg?v=1727742844"}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0867\/1120\/6219\/collections\/test_8c7da023_thumbnail_4096_51013cd4-53df-42c5-9f0c-7d250e7ca8c0.jpg?v=1727181992","url":"https:\/\/shop.roughtrade.com\/fr\/collections\/mega-bog.oembed","provider":"Rough Trade","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
